    I originally housed my rescues together because they had always been together and I was worried if I separated them I would have problems. My female used to do the same exact thing, killing it and rubbing her nose all over the prey but leaving it because she was insecure about the other snake. I got them to eat but I would have to take one snake out to feed the other, so I eventually gave up and moved them both to tubs. So that would be my advice. Even though she was previously housed with another snake he might just be insecure because it's a new environment and because he doesn't really "know" the new housemate. Buy a tub, get him eating regularly and then decide if you want to introduce them again (I don't recommend this).

    Just my two cents...get a moderate sized tub, put him in, and try feeding him in there. Like other have said, separate the snakes and when the little one-eyed one feeds, put a towel or something over the enclosure. Snakes that are shy like a little privacy. Remember that for a snake, eating and shedding are times when they are EXTREMELY vulnerable in the wild, so they instinctively get a little edgy if they feel threatened at those times.
